Professor Kim Gisu of Dong-A University Elected as New President of the Korean Society for the Preservation of Modern Architecture
Professor Kim Gisu of the Department of Architecture at Dong-A University has been elected as the president of the Korea Modern Architecture Preservation Society (DOCOMOMO Korea).
Professor Kim was chosen as the 7th president at the recent extraordinary board meeting and general assembly of the Korea Modern Architecture Preservation Society held at the Paichai Hakdang History Museum in Jeong-dong, Jung-gu, Seoul.
The Korea Modern Architecture Preservation Society is a member organization of DOCOMOMO International, a UNESCO-registered international organization, and this year marks its 20th anniversary since establishment.
The society has conducted regular academic seminars, modern architecture field trips, and contests for the preservation and utilization of modern architectural structures. It also hosted the DOCOMOMO International General Assembly and academic conference for the first time in an Asian country.
Professor Kim Gisu stated, “I will strive to secure human and material resources for civil society experts’ activities, such as resuming suspended academic activities and contests for modern architecture preservation.”
Professor Kim graduated from the Department of Architectural Engineering at Dong-A University and earned his master's and doctoral degrees in architecture from Kyoto Institute of Technology in Japan. Since 2001, he has been teaching at his alma mater, nurturing future scholars. He has also served as the chair of the Policy Subcommittee of the Busan City Architectural Policy Committee, a member of the Urban Planning Committee, and is currently the director of the Seokdang Museum at Dong-A University.
